Our research focuses on fundamental aspects of fabrication and function of advanced electronically active materials. Particular areas of interest include:
- Atomic Layer Deposition, for highly confromal fabrication of inorganic insulators and metals with atomic-scale control of growth and interface formation
- Molecular Electronics, to better understand charge motion and electrical contacts to molecular ensembles and single molecules.
- Nanotube Structures,
including synthesis, assembly, electrical characterization, and
reactions involving carbon nanotubes
- Low Temperature Processing, including supercritical-solvent and plasma processes to enable novel electronic devices on plastic substrates.
- Bio-Mimetic Molecular Photovoltaics, using porphyrin materials to help enable low cost high performance energy generation.
